The video explores the concept of intelligence across different ages, highlighting the annual Brain Clash event where Amir must choose a teammate. It discusses how intelligence is not solely defined by IQ tests but involves creativity, memory, and learning. The video examines brain development from childhood to adulthood, noting that children excel in language learning and creativity, while adults have better focus and memory. Adolescents are dynamic learners with a developing prefrontal cortex. The conclusion emphasizes that intelligence varies with age, suggesting that an age-diverse team is beneficial.
